[Qemu-devel] [PATCH 00/16 v4] target-i386: CPU hot-add with cpu-add QMP


From: Igor Mammedov
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H 00/16 v4] target-i386: CPU hot-add with cpu-add QMP command
Date: Tue, 16 Apr 2013 00:12:40 +0200

Implements alternative way for hot-adding CPU using cpu-add QMP command,
wich could be useful until it would be possible to add CPUs via device_add.

All patches except the last are also applicable to device_add aprroach.

To hot-add CPU use following command from qmp-shell:
 cpu-add id=[0..max-cpus - 1)

v4->v3:
  * 'id' in cpu-add command will be a thread number instead of APIC ID
  * split off resume_vcpu() into separate patch
  * move notifier from rtc code into pc.c

v2->v3:
  * use local error & propagate_error() instead of operating on
    passed in errp in several places
  * replace CPUClass.get_firmware_id() with CPUClass.get_arch_id()
  * leave IOAPIC creation to board and just set bus to icc-bus
  * include kvm-stub.o in cpu libary if no KVM is configured
  * create resume_vcpu() stub and include it in libqemustub,
    and use it directly instead of CPU method
  * acpi_piix4: s/cpu_add_notifier/cpu_added_notifier/

v1->v2:
  * generalize cpu sync to KVM, resume and hot-plug notification and
    invoke them form CPUClass, to make available to all targets.
  * introduce cpu_exists() and CPUClass.get_firmware_id() and use
    the last one in acpi_piix to make code target independent.
  * move IOAPIC to ICC bus, it was suggested and easy to convert.
  * leave kvmvapic as SysBusDevice, it doesn't affect hot-plug and
    created only once for all APIC instances. I haven't found yet
    good/clean enough way to convert it to ICCDevice. May be follow-up
    though.
  * split one big ICC patch into several, one per converted device
  * add cpu_hot_add hook to machine and implement it for target-i386,
    instead of adding stabs. Could be used by other targets to
    implement cpu-add.
  * pre-allocate links<CPU> for all possible CPUs and make them available
    at /machine/icc-bridge/cpu[0..N] QOM path, so users could find out
    possible/free CPU IDs to use in cpu-add command.
